I highly recommend the Canon Powershot SD line. I've had one for years,
and it's been great. My wife got the 'SD1100IS'
(http://www.amazon.com/Canon-PowerShot-SD1100IS-Digital-Stabilized/dp/B0012YC7AE/ref=sr_1_1?ie=UTF8&s=electronics&qid=1235748290&sr=1-1)
model last year, and it also takes fantastic pictures. I've recommended
them to friends, and everyone who has bought one loves it. It's
shirtpocket small, but has great optics and firmware; the pictures are
generally outstanding. I've had photography snobs see my pictures and
be wowed, then try to start a conversation about what kind of fancy
gear I used. When I tell 'em it was just a little pocket
point-and-shoot camera they look startled and change the subject.
Battery life is very good (obviously longer if you're not using the
flash), but get a spare battery anyway, so you can keep using the
camera while one battery is in the charger. And of course, get a big SD
card or two (8 GB cards have come way down in price, and hold a ton of
photos). Oh, and get one that has an actual viewfinder window, in
addition to the LCD screen. You might not use it often, but there are
times when it comes in handy.
